โœฆ Synopsis


A study was made on effect of niobium on the GdVO 4 crystal structure. Yb:GdV 0.995 Nb 0.005 O 4 crystals were grown by the Czochralski method, and their transmission spectra, absorption spectra, and fluorescence spectra were measured. The GdV 0.995 Nb 0.005 O 4 crystals acting as new laser host crystals do not affect the absorption of Yb 3+ . Some spectrum parameters calculated by the Fuchbauer-Ladenburger method indicate that doping of Nb 5+ in the GdVO 4 crystal improves the spectroscopic properties of Yb 3+ .
